            ADC121S101 is a low-power, single-channel 12-bit analog-to-digital converter high-speed serial interface CMOS. ADC121S101 is different from the conventional practice, only a single sample rate specifies the performance and fully meets the specified technical specifications beyond the sample rate range of 500 ksps  1 MSPS  。 The converter is based on successive approximation register structures with internal track and hold circuitry. 
            The output serial data is binary and is compatible with several standards, such as SPI™, QSPI™,  MICROWIRE  Serial interface with many common DSPs. 
            ADC121S101 operation and single supply can range from +2.7 V to +5.25 V. The power consumption for +3 V or +5 V power supply is 2.0 MW and 10 MW, respectively. Power-down function reduces power consumption to as low as 2.6 microwatts using a +5 V power supply. 
            ADC121S101 are packaged in 6-pin LLP and SOT-23 packages. Guaranteed industrial temperature range above -40°C to +125°C.
